Course Details
• Introduction to Digital Forensics: Understanding the basics, best practices, and legal aspects of digital forensics. This unit will provide an overview of the field, setting the stage for advanced topics.
• Computer Forensics Fundamentals: Learning about data acquisition, analysis, and reporting for computer systems. This unit will cover file system basics, memory analysis, and data recovery techniques.
• Mobile Device Forensics: Exploring mobile device operating systems, data acquisition methods, and analysis techniques. This unit will focus on iOS and Android platforms and their unique challenges.
• Network Forensics: Delving into network traffic analysis, log analysis, and incident response. This unit will emphasize identifying and mitigating cyber threats, malware, and unauthorized access.
• Cloud Forensics: Investigating data stored in cloud environments, including data recovery, analysis, and compliance with legal and regulatory requirements. This unit will also cover virtual machine forensics.
• Digital Forensics Tools and Techniques: Hands-on experience with popular digital forensics tools and techniques, including open-source and commercial solutions. This unit will help students develop practical skills in data acquisition and analysis.
• Cyber Threat Intelligence: Understanding cyber threat intelligence sources, data analysis, and actionable insights for digital forensics. This unit will cover threat hunting, malware analysis, and incident response planning.
• Ethics and Professional Standards in Digital Forensics: Examining ethical considerations, professional standards, and industry best practices in digital forensics. This unit will emphasize integrity, confidentiality, and the importance of ethical decision-making.
• Emerging Trends in Digital Forensics: Exploring the latest trends and challenges in digital forensics, including artificial intelligence, machine learning, and the Internet of Things (IoT). This unit will encourage critical thinking and future-proof skills.
